Evgeny Minchenko, Head of the Minchenko Consulting communications holding, highlighted the most important moments of the concept of the new foreign policy of the Russian Federation, approved by Russian President Vladimir Putin.
“Vladimir Putin approved a new charter for Russia. Our country has now been declared an independent and original civilization that should not be integrated anywhere. “We can now safely say that Russia rejects the idea of authorizing the common European world,” he said.
According to him, Putin specifically identified Russia’s partner countries.
“The countries with which Russia plans to interact (China, India, Iran, Syria and others) are specially named. Priorities regarding integration into the Eurasian space were highlighted. “At the moment, Russia is striving to transform Eurasia into a single continental space of peace and stability,” said Minchenko.
The expert also noted that Russia will make efforts to help Europe free itself from the Anglo-Saxon illusion.
“The concept is the separation of Europe from the USA. Europe has always been closer to Russia. Many European countries are experiencing economic losses due to NATO’s policies. The expert said that Russia offered Europe to regain its sovereignty.
Earlier, the President of Russia signed a decree confirming the concept of the updated foreign policy of the Russian Federation. The head of state announced this at an operational meeting with the permanent members of the Security Council.
